Output 28a68c35763fc61b0853bd59c6797329fa1fdb5fe408e69cc2b2ae8a51330510:3

value
45258311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52047cd676326820e5753efe6118a9eced07fa87 OP_EQUAL
address
MFNq1y4twbTuAzZS92Si1DXw17KpLXP362
transaction
28a68c35763fc61b0853bd59c6797329fa1fdb5fe408e69cc2b2ae8a51330510
spent
true